DB2 Catalog 与 Schema
发布网友
发布时间:2022-04-26 22:26
我来回答
共2个回答
热心网友
时间:2022-04-10 06:16
catalog在DB2中就是编目的意思,可以对接点node或者database进行catalog(编目)。
就是将数据库database物理层和数据库管理逻辑层建立关系,这样用户、DB2管理服务就可以对数据库进行管理和操作。
比如当你发出
DB2 CREATE DB TESTDB
系统会自动创建数据库TESTDB,并自动Catalog编目,这个很容易理解。
catalog还可以编目远程接点,然后编目远程数据库。
db2 catalog tcpip node db2node remote 远程数据库IP server 端口;
db2 catalog db 数据库名 at node db2node;
同样可以uncatalog,意思反过来的。
Schema:模式
模式是表的上一层,类似于Oracle的用户下的表一下。
在scott用户下建表啊,切换到另外一个用户要加上模式名select * from scott.a;
DB2下不用新建用户,直接DB2 CREATE SCHEMA scott01;
然后建表create table scott01.a(id int);
因为DB2的用户和操作系统层是关联的,如果你create table 不加模式名,会默认为当前登录用户。
希望你理解,可以帮你,这些东西很简单,所以懂了就行不用太纠结这个。
热心网友
时间:2022-04-10 07:34
catalog与schema都是数据库容器命名空间上的一个层次,一个数据库管理系统管理多个catalog,一个catalog有多个schema,catalog一般对应于数据库名称,schema一般对应于用户名或对象的拥有者名称
到底DB2 catalog是什么东西?
解,具体来说编目有编目节点,编目数据库等。如果要理解编目,我先简单讲一下DB2数据库的体系结构,在DB2数据库中最大的概念是系统(节点)也就是主机,下面是实例,实例下面是数据库,然后是表空间,然后是数据库对象。现在假设你有一个数据库服务器在p570的机器上,你有一个客户端在db2 catalog tcp...
labtechgroup
LabTech Group,即北京莱伯泰科仪器股份有限公司,是业界领先的实验室科学仪器与解决方案提供商。我们专注于分析测试仪器的研发、生产和销售,致力于为全球科研工作者、高校及企业实验室提供高性能、高稳定性的产品与服务。通过持续的技术创新与品质提升,LabTech Group在样品前处理、光谱分析、色谱分析等领域不断突破,助力科学探索与产业升级,携手客户共创科研新篇章。北京莱伯泰科仪器股份有限公司北京莱伯泰科仪器股份有限公司成立于2002年,是一家专业从事实验分析仪器的研发、生产和销售的科技型公司。莱伯泰科自成立之初便致力于为环境检测、食品安全、疾病控制、半导体检测、生命科学、能源化工、核环保、...
db2数据库如何连接(db2数据库连接命令)
1.首先将数据库服务端的数据库映射到客户端(因为使用ODBC的原因)映射命令如下:Db2cmd Db2 //将远程节点192.168.80.207:50001映射为node207本地节点 catalogtcpipnodenode207remote192.168.80.207server50001 //映射数据库zcldb到本地node207节点 catalogdatabasezcldbatnodenode207 2.新增ODBC,连...
哪位高手知道DB2的常用命令是什么哦?麻烦说一下,谢谢啦
db2 catalog tcpip node <接点名称> remote <远程数据库地址> server <端口号> --把远程数据库映射到本地接点一般为50000 db2 catalog db <远程数据库名称> as <接点名称> at node PUB11 --远程数据库名称到本地接点 db2 CONNECT TO <接点名称> user <用户名> using <密码> -...
如何处理创建DB2工具目录数据库的时候遇到的SQL1005N错误?
解答产生这个错误的原因在于:删除工具目录数据库时,必须在删除数据库本身的同时将工具目录一同删除。如下是解决该问题具体步骤:1.删除工具目录(以工具目录名为SYSTOOLS举例)db2 “drop tools catalog systools in database toolsdb”2.删除工具数据库 db2 ”drop db toolsdb”3.停止DAS db2admin sto...
如何用DB2客户端连接远程数据库
连接远程DB2数据库服务的基本步骤如下:1. 在客户机上对远程DB2节点进行编目。2. 在客户机上对远程数据库进行编目。一、第一步 首先在客户机上对远程节点进行编目,这里需要确认远程主机在客户机上的名称、IP地址、端口号等基本命令如下:1. CATALOG TCPIP //编目一个TCP/IP节点 NODE local_no...
想从事银行方面的c语言开发,他上面还要了解db2数据库的常用操作_百度知 ...
2、 db2 -tvf crtdb.sql crtdb.sql文件内容:create db btpdbs on /db2catalog db2 -stvf crttbl.sql db2move btpdbs import 十、DB2帮助命令: db2 ? db2 ? restroe db2 ? sqlcode (例:db2 ? sql0803) 注:code必须为4位数,不够4位,前面补0 十一、bind命令:将应用程序与数据库作一捆绑,每次恢复...
db2有表空间的LRG跟FLG文件,能恢复出来吗?
1.)把数据库文件路径换为/home/db2users/e105q6a/targetdbdir 2.) 把IBMSTOGROUP的路径换为/home/db2users/e105q6a/targetstgrpsystem 3.)把MQSGROUP的路径换为/home/db2users/e105q6a/targetstgrpuser1, /home/db2users/e105q6a/targetstgrpuser2 和/home/db2users/e105q6a/targetstgrpuser3 4...
DB2千万或亿级的数据如何存储性能才最好
db2 list db directory $disk $disk 换成你的D:盘或者E:盘,DB2 Windows只允许安装在盘符根目录下,这样就可以查看到盘里是否有数据库,如果发现了catalog一下数据库就回来了
db2在线备份和离线备份都是什么后缀
db2adutl query 命令也可以看到返回值。5)、备注:首先对主节点(catalog表空间在的节点)执行备份命令,再对另外的节点也做这个操作。2、 在线备份:1)、首先打开一下支持在线备份的数据库配置参数:db2 update db cfg for sample using userexit on 启用用户出口 db2 update db cfg for sample...
如何使用db2ckbkp命令查看DB2数据库备份的类型
db2ckbkp -H WWQ.0.gmcw.NODE0000.CATN0000.20130107000019.001 我们可以通过上述输出中的Backup Mode, Backup Type 和Backup Gran.来确定备份的类型,三个关键字的说明如下:Backup Mode 0 - offline(脱机备份), 1 - online(联机备份)Backup Type 0 - full(全备份), 3 - tablespace(表...